Asparagus has fasciculated roots that arise in a bunch from a lower node of the stem and become fleshy for the storage of food. It is a type of modified adventitious root. Underground stems of potato (tuber), ginger and turmeric (rhizome), zaminkand and colocasia (corm) are used for food storage and vegetative propagation. Onion is a modified underground stem called the bulb. This stem is reduced and has a disc-like structure and surrounds with numerous fleshly scaly leaves.
